Mexican Chicken Adobo Tacos
A fusion of Mexican and Filipino flavors, this dish is a twist on traditional Mexican street food. The tender chicken is marinated in a mixture of soy sauce, vinegar, garlic, and chili peppers, then grilled to perfection and served in a taco shell.
Ingredients
- β1 1/2 pounds chicken breastsboneless, skinless
- β2 tablespoons filipino adobo mix
- β2 limesjuiced
- β3 cloves garlicminced
- β1/4 cup chipotle peppers in adobo saucediced
- β1 teaspoon cumin
- β1/2 teaspoon paprika
- β8-10 corn tortillas
- β1 cup shredded cheeseoptional
Instructions
- 1
In a blender or food processor, combine adobo mix, lime juice, garlic, chipotle peppers, cumin, and paprika. Blend until smooth.
- 2
Place the chicken breasts in a large zip-top plastic bag or a sh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the chicken and massage to coat.
- 3
Ref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ight.
- 4
Preheat grill to medium-high heat.
- 5
Remove the chicken from the marinade and cook for 5-7 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
- 6
Transfer the chicken to a cutting board and let rest for 5 minutes.
- 7
Shred the chicken into bite-sized pieces.
- 8
Warm the tortillas by wrapping them in a damp paper towel and microwaving for 20-30 seconds.
- 9
Assemble the tacos by spooning the shredded chicken onto a tortilla and topping with cheese, if desired.
